Ethereum
Block
21165269
0x37914fc2a24afeed166d2b959122db6f191a8e0b
EOA
Active on
Ethereum with -- and
50 txns
Funded by
0x7232
…
8d52
via
0xa3d5
…
1baa
First active
6 years ago
Last active
3 months ago
Loading...